My 87-year old husband and I are visiting Philadelphia and were walking along Christopher Columbus Blvd. from our motel, Comfort Inn. We were on our way to GiGis Restaurant on Market Street. A driver of a DOT van insisted that we get into his van and he would take us to our destination. We were unfamiliar with the city, but knew we were quite close to our destination. I asked him how much we would owe him and he said "not too much and not too little". We had to insist that he let us out on Market Street, our destination, and he drove us 6 to 7 blocks beyond and was annoyed at the amount of money my husband gave him. He honked his horn and made my husband give him more money and honked again and demanded more money. We should not have gotten in his van, but it definitely had DOT and numbers on the side to give us every indication he was legitimate.

The monetary amount is insignificant, but this man was preying on two elderly people who had to find our way back to our hotel in a very unfamiliar city. We don't want it to happen to others.

I'm sorry I did not get the numbers written on the van, but we were very upset and I did not have a pen. This man is dangerous to elderly people and needs to be stopped. Monetary value is not an issue, we just want his employer to know his scam. This happened at approximately 5:30 to 6:00 p.m. on June 14.
